Abstract
Sputtered Co-(15-19 at%) Fe films were prepared, varying the Ar gas pressure and substrate temperature as parameters. The relationships between the film magnetic properties and crystal structure were investigated. Films with an fcc phase (111) preferred orientation showed relatively high Hc values of more than 8 Oe and a Bs of about 19 kG. Films with a bec phase (110) preferred orientation showed low Hc values of 2 to 3 Oe, comparable to the values for single-layered Fe-base films, and a Bs of about 21 kG. It was verified that this difference in Hc is not attributable to differences in internal stress or in crystallite size.
